Property Insights of J1.550.932E

The XLogP value of 3.06 indicates that J1.550.932E is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 87.36 Ų falls within the moderate polarity range, balancing permeability and solubility for J1.550.932E. Following Lipinski's Rule of Five, J1.550.932E has 1 hydrogen bond donor(s) and 8 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
